#162: The Discovery Call Framework My Students Use to Consistently Book Brand Photography Clients

When I was a wedding and portrait photographer, I avoided discovery calls like the plague. I’m a classic millennial and just didn’t want to get on a phone call.

Now, as a brand photographer, discovery calls are a major source of income, and I’m a huge advocate for them.

I know discovery calls can feel awkward and salesy, but this episode is going to flip that script. I’m walking you through the exact framework my students use to turn warm leads into dream brand photography clients through discovery calls.
